"In the heart of the city of Sapporo, the Knot is a boutique hotel that feels both urban and rural. It’s dedicated to the idea of Sapporo as a city surrounded by nature, and its aesthetic, accordingly, is one part big-city loft style and one part rugged and rustic. There’s a touch of àpres-ski vibe in the lobby lounge, and many of the rooms feature walls made from local cedar. Les Bois is the name of the lounge restaurant, the venue for everything from breakfast to late-night dinner and drinks, and also in the building is a Seicomart convenience store and Senshuan, a famous local confectionery." - Tablet Hotels

I stayed at The Knot Sapporo with my husband during the 2024 Snow Festival. We splurged for the Deluxe King room and had no regrets. The extra square footage made it easier to relax, and the view was spectacular, especially at night. The bathroom, furniture, and decor were all great as well — modern, comfortable, and clean. The location was one of the main reasons I chose this hotel, and it fully met my expectations. There's an entrance from the basement floor into the underground shopping mall, which was really convenient, and we were able to easily walk to the festival area as well as restaurants, stores, and metro stations. The staff was really helpful any time we needed something. We arrived one day later than expected due to an issue with our train from Hakodate, and I had trouble reaching the hotel by phone. I ended up emailing the contact listed in my reservation confirmation, and I received a prompt reply reassuring me that our reservation would be kept and that our room would be ready when we arrived. As promised, everything was ready to go when we got there the following morning, so we were able to get started on sightseeing right away. Strong recommend for this hotel and for this neighborhood.

Location is incredible if you are a tourist. Connects directly to pole town (underground mall) and walkable from Sapporo station. There is a Seicomart on ground floor and the hotel is 50m to Tanukukoji Street - which you are bound to visit a few times during your visit anyway. The views are great,the room are clean and you get few free drinks to top it off.
